c++ 两个井号

来源:互联网 发布:超星网络课程登录 编辑:程序博客网 时间:2024/04/27 22:45
连接作用例如:
A ## B等于AB(连接A和B并去掉空格)
 

##在C/C++的预处理系统中用来做 符号连接


#define REPLACE(x) old_##x = my_table[__NR_##x];/
  sys_call_table[__NR_##x] = new_##x

例如:
REPLACE(1) 展开后的语句:
old_1 = my_table[__NR_1];
sys_call_table[__NR_1] = new_1

原创粉丝点击